[ Upstream commit e8e032cd24dda7cceaa27bc2eb627f82843f0466 ] The ERR007885 will lead to a TDAR race condition for mutliQ when the driver sets TDAR and the UDMA clears TDAR simultaneously or in a small window (2-4 cycles). And it will cause the udma_tx and udma_tx_arbiter state machines to hang. Therefore, the commit53bb20d1fa("net: fec: add variable reg_desc_active to speed things up") and the commit a179aad12bad ("net: fec: ERR007885 Workaround for conventional TX") have added the workaround to fix the potential issue for the conventional TX path. Similarly, the XDP TX path should also have the potential hang issue, so add the workaround for XDP TX path. Linux kernel
============
There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.
In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``. The formatted documentation can also be read online at:
https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/
There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.
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
